**单片机设计介绍,基于单片机PID温度控制热水器
一 概要
基于单片机PID温度控制热水器概要如下:
一、引言
热水器作为家庭生活中不可或缺的设备,其温度控制的稳定性和精确性对于用户体验至关重要。基于单片机PID温度控制的热水器设计,通过引入PID控制算法,结合单片机技术,实现对热水器水温的精确控制,提高了热水器的性能和使用体验。
二、系统组成
单片机核心控制模块:选用具有强大处理能力和丰富接口的单片机作为控制核心,如AT89C52等。该模块负责接收温度传感器的信号,执行PID控制算法,并控制执行器(如加热元件)实现温度的精确调节。
温度传感器:用于实时检测热水器内的水温,并将温度信号转换为电信号输出给单片机。常见的温度传感器有DS18B20等。
显示模块:采用LCD或LED显示屏,用于显示当前水温和设定水温等信息,方便用户观察和调整。
按键模块:提供用户与热水器之间的交互接口,用户可以通过按键设置水温档位、调整温度等。
执行器:如加热元件,根据单片机的控制信号调节加热功率,实现水温的调节。
三、PID温度控制原理
PID控制器是一种基于比例(P)、积分(I)、微分(D)三个控制参数的控制系统。在本系统中,PID控制算法通过调节这三个参数来实现对水温的精确控制。具体过程如下:
比例控制:根据当前水温与目标水温之间的误差